Unearthing Joy in Simple Things

Life frequently get us caught up in the busyness of everyday existence. We strive bigger goals, dream of grand experiences, and sometimes miss the Gratitude simple joys that encompass us every day.

Making a moment to recognize these little moments can dramatically shift your perspective. A warm cup of coffee on a chilly morning, the joy of a loved one, the peaceful sound of rain, or even just the feeling of sunshine bathing your skin - these simple things can ignite a sense of deep happiness.
